<|fim_start|>`The video surveillance industry is undergoing a transformation with the integration of artificial intelligence (AI) technologies, enabling intelligent, real-time decision-making and data analysis. AI-powered video surveillance tools can process, analyze, and generate insights in real-time, improving accuracy, response times, and security operations while automating manual tasks. To fully leverage AI, vector databases are crucial for managing vast amounts of visual and sensor data. The integration of AI and vector databases is paving the way for faster, smarter security operations that can scale to meet the growing demands of real-time surveillance. However, ensuring privacy, compliance with regulations, and maintaining secure video storage and access controls remain significant challenges. Human oversight remains essential in AI-enhanced surveillance, augmenting human capabilities rather than replacing them. For developers looking to integrate AI and vector databases, assessing current infrastructure, choosing the right database, prioritizing data security and compliance, investing in training, and starting with pilot programs are key recommendations.
